<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Dynamic dimensional scope in QlikView</title>
    <link>https://community.qlik.com/t5/QlikView/Dynamic-dimensional-scope/m-p/1669189#M728741</link>
    <description>&lt;P&gt;Hi Emanuel, I think you attempt was close, can you try it using a $-expansion syntax?:&lt;/P&gt;&lt;LI-CODE lang="markup"&gt;= Count(DISTINCT my_value) 
/
Count( TOTAL &amp;lt;$(=GetFieldSelections(dim_selected))&amp;gt; DISTINCT my_value)&lt;/LI-CODE&gt;&lt;P&gt;Or using concat:&lt;/P&gt;&lt;LI-CODE lang="markup"&gt;= Count(DISTINCT my_value) 
/
Count( TOTAL &amp;lt;$(=Concat(dim_selected,','))&amp;gt; DISTINCT my_value)&lt;/LI-CODE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
    <pubDate>Sun, 26 Jan 2020 09:56:43 GMT</pubDate>
    <dc:creator>rubenmarin</dc:creator>
    <dc:date>2020-01-26T09:56:43Z</dc:date>
    <item>
      <title>Dynamic dimensional scope</title>
      <link>https://community.qlik.com/t5/QlikView/Dynamic-dimensional-scope/m-p/1669037#M728740</link>
      <description>&lt;P&gt;Hi all,&lt;/P&gt;&lt;P&gt;I'm trying to create a report composer where the users can create pivot tables by their own choosing which dimensions and expressions show in the table.&amp;nbsp;&lt;BR /&gt;Everything seems to work fine until I need to show the row relative values (%).&lt;/P&gt;&lt;P&gt;Absolute:&lt;/P&gt;&lt;TABLE border="1"&gt;&lt;TBODY&gt;&lt;TR&gt;&lt;TD&gt;dim1&lt;/TD&gt;&lt;TD&gt;dim2&lt;/TD&gt;&lt;TD&gt;exp1&lt;/TD&gt;&lt;TD&gt;exp2&lt;/TD&gt;&lt;TD&gt;total&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;x&lt;/TD&gt;&lt;TD&gt;a&lt;/TD&gt;&lt;TD&gt;10&lt;/TD&gt;&lt;TD&gt;90&lt;/TD&gt;&lt;TD&gt;100&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;&amp;nbsp;&lt;/TD&gt;&lt;TD&gt;b&lt;/TD&gt;&lt;TD&gt;30&lt;/TD&gt;&lt;TD&gt;30&lt;/TD&gt;&lt;TD&gt;60&lt;/TD&gt;&lt;/TR&gt;&lt;/TBODY&gt;&lt;/TABLE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Relative:&lt;/P&gt;&lt;TABLE border="1"&gt;&lt;TBODY&gt;&lt;TR&gt;&lt;TD&gt;dim1&lt;/TD&gt;&lt;TD&gt;dim2&lt;/TD&gt;&lt;TD&gt;exp1&lt;/TD&gt;&lt;TD&gt;exp2&lt;/TD&gt;&lt;TD&gt;total&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;x&lt;/TD&gt;&lt;TD&gt;a&lt;/TD&gt;&lt;TD&gt;10%&lt;/TD&gt;&lt;TD&gt;90%&lt;/TD&gt;&lt;TD&gt;100%&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;&amp;nbsp;&lt;/TD&gt;&lt;TD&gt;b&lt;/TD&gt;&lt;TD&gt;50%&lt;/TD&gt;&lt;TD&gt;50%&lt;/TD&gt;&lt;TD&gt;100%&lt;/TD&gt;&lt;/TR&gt;&lt;/TBODY&gt;&lt;/TABLE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;LI-CODE lang="markup"&gt;= Count(DISTINCT my_value) 
/
Count( TOTAL &amp;lt;dim1, dim2&amp;gt; DISTINCT my_value)&lt;/LI-CODE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;In this case i can easily define which are my dimensional scopes (&lt;EM&gt;dim1&lt;/EM&gt; and &lt;EM&gt;dim2&lt;/EM&gt;) to obtain the correct relative value. But what about if user needs to add &lt;EM&gt;dim3&lt;/EM&gt;? This change my formula to:&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;LI-CODE lang="markup"&gt;= Count(DISTINCT my_value) 
/
Count( TOTAL &amp;lt;dim1, dim2, dim3&amp;gt; DISTINCT my_value)&lt;/LI-CODE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Is it possible to do it dynamically?&amp;nbsp;&lt;/P&gt;&lt;P&gt;I tried something like:&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;LI-CODE lang="markup"&gt;= Count(DISTINCT my_value) 
/
Count( TOTAL &amp;lt;GetFieldSelections(dim_selected)&amp;gt; DISTINCT my_value)&lt;/LI-CODE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;or using variables to get the selected fields or, even, converting total to set analysis but without any success.&lt;/P&gt;&lt;P&gt;Can somebody help me please?&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Thanks in advance,&lt;BR /&gt;Emanuele&lt;/P&gt;</description>
      <pubDate>Sat, 16 Nov 2024 19:14:05 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Dynamic-dimensional-scope/m-p/1669037#M728740</guid>
      <dc:creator>Eman</dc:creator>
      <dc:date>2024-11-16T19:14:05Z</dc:date>
    </item>
    <item>
      <title>Re: Dynamic dimensional scope</title>
      <link>https://community.qlik.com/t5/QlikView/Dynamic-dimensional-scope/m-p/1669189#M728741</link>
      <description>&lt;P&gt;Hi Emanuel, I think you attempt was close, can you try it using a $-expansion syntax?:&lt;/P&gt;&lt;LI-CODE lang="markup"&gt;= Count(DISTINCT my_value) 
/
Count( TOTAL &amp;lt;$(=GetFieldSelections(dim_selected))&amp;gt; DISTINCT my_value)&lt;/LI-CODE&gt;&lt;P&gt;Or using concat:&lt;/P&gt;&lt;LI-CODE lang="markup"&gt;= Count(DISTINCT my_value) 
/
Count( TOTAL &amp;lt;$(=Concat(dim_selected,','))&amp;gt; DISTINCT my_value)&lt;/LI-CODE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Sun, 26 Jan 2020 09:56:43 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Dynamic-dimensional-scope/m-p/1669189#M728741</guid>
      <dc:creator>rubenmarin</dc:creator>
      <dc:date>2020-01-26T09:56:43Z</dc:date>
    </item>
    <item>
      <title>Re: Dynamic dimensional scope</title>
      <link>https://community.qlik.com/t5/QlikView/Dynamic-dimensional-scope/m-p/1669519#M728742</link>
      <description>&lt;P&gt;Hi Ruben,&lt;/P&gt;&lt;P&gt;first solution works properly! Thank you very much!&lt;/P&gt;</description>
      <pubDate>Mon, 27 Jan 2020 11:54:41 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Dynamic-dimensional-scope/m-p/1669519#M728742</guid>
      <dc:creator>Eman</dc:creator>
      <dc:date>2020-01-27T11:54:41Z</dc:date>
    </item>
  </channel>
</rss>

